George Takei Set to Guest Star in Archie Comics’ ‘Kevin Keller’ Series
The fictional town of Riverdale has seen many real-life famous celebrities give the place a visit. Coming this November with the release of 'Kevin Keller' #6 is the man Hikaru Sulu himself -- George Takei! For those who haven't read Archie Comics in a while, Kevin Keller is the first openly gay character. Conveniently enough, Takei is openly gay too.

TopBrewer Coffee Faucet Will Change Your Caffeine Fix Forever
Love coffee? Hate waking up to make it the old fashion way? Well, Danish company Scanomat has unveiled what is quite possibly the coolest-looking solution for every coffee addict out there. It's called the TopBrewer Coffee Faucet, and yes, the coffee comes out of a faucet.
